Air Arabia Expands European Routes from Morocco with 23 New Destinations

With the resumption of the Moroccan airline Air Arabia’s exceptional flights on Wednesday, 23 new destinations have been added. These are connections from Moroccan cities to several European countries.
According to the commercial management of the Moroccan low-cost company, these flights depart from Casablanca to Brussels, Barcelona, Lyon, Montpellier, Toulouse, Pisa, Venice, Milan Bergamo, Bologna, Catania, Turin Cuneo, Naples, Pal Mulhouse, Istanbul and Tunis. Some of the company’s flights also connect Fez to Amsterdam, Brussels, Barcelona, Bordeaux, Paris, Lyon, Montpellier, Strasbourg and Toulouse. The departures from Nador concern the cities of Barcelona, Cologne, Palma de Mallorca and Montpellier.
As for the flights from Tangier, they connect Amsterdam, Brussels, London, Barcelona, Madrid, Malaga, Lyon and Paris. According to the company, this new program is subject to change depending on the evolution of the situation.
These special Air Arabia flights started following the government decision taken on July 14 to allow Moroccan citizens, foreign residents in Morocco and their families to return to Morocco and leave, according to the new health measures issued by the competent authorities.
According to a company press release, all passengers on these routes must wear a mask throughout the flight. Temperature taking is also required before boarding.
